Phil Ament I have always been a sifi reader since my teen age days. Eventually, story ideas started popping into my head. I had no idea how much work it takes to write a full length story until I was a few chapters into my first completed book. Now I can't stop. Its an obsession.
Phil Ament I am currently working on two stories. One is about a teen age girl's adventure escaping from a back water ag planet where your only future is working in the fields. The other story is about a therapist who is abducted while on a camping hike to be trained as a pet for an alien race. It turns out, aliens need therapy to.
Phil Ament I'll tell you the same thing a successful sifi writer told me. Write at least one page a day, every day, no excuses. This is the same advice he received when he first started his writing career.
Phil Ament A writer has the potential to be able to live anywhere. As an engineer, I always had to live in or near high tech cities. That freedom was a big motivator to become a writer.
Phil Ament I sit down and write one word, any word, it doesn't matter. Then I add a word. I try to put myself mentally in the scene and then describe it. I find most of my writer's block is actually procrastination. I always have something like a chore that needs to be done first.
